AI-driven cyclodextrin drug design

Fascinating research by Amelia Anderson & Matthew “Oki” O’Connor from Cyclarity Therapeutics and Angel Piñeiro & Rebeca Garcia-Fandino from Universidad de Santiago de Compostela

Computational methods represent an exceptional complement to in vitro assays because they can be employed for existing and hypothetical molecules, providing high resolution structures in addition to a mechanistic, dynamic, kinetic, and thermodynamic characterization.

Bridging computational methods with complex molecular interactions, this research enables predictive CD designs for diverse applications. Moreover, the high reproducibility, sensitivity, and cost-effectiveness of the studied methods pave the way for extensive studies of massive CD-ligand combinations, enabling AI algorithm training and automated molecular design.

Preparation of Carvacrol β-Cyclodextrin Inclusions and 1-Methylcyclopropene-α-CD Coated Paper by Water-Free Method for Postharvest Preservation of Peach

Today’s cyclodextrin: is a packaging/food preservation application

Where Carvacrol β-Cyclodextrin Inclusions and 1-Methylcyclopropene-α-CD Coated Paper are for post-harvest preservation of peach.

Carvacrol essential oil has broad-spectrum antibacterial properties, but it is volatile and unstable for long-term storage and use. In the present study, carvacrol was encapsulated with β-cyclodextrin to improve its relevant properties.

PEG was used to form the film in the anhydrous condition, and the compound and ethylene inhibitor 1-methylcyclopropene (1-MCP) were included to obtain the film-coated paper.

This study provides a solution for preparing controlled-release coated paper with essential oils and 1-MCP bioactives to extend the shelf life of fruits and vegetables.
